The San Diego Padres hold home-field advantage at pitcher-friendly Petco Park in Thursday's series finale against the Seattle Mariners, following a 4-1 victory in Monday's opener where Michael King dominated and Xander Bogaerts delivered three hits and three RBI. Probable starters Luis Castillo (0-0, 6.92 ERA) for Seattle and Walker Buehler (0-1, 4.97 ERA, off a strong six scoreless innings versus the Rockies) tilt trader consensus toward San Diego's 11-6 record over the Mariners' 8-10 mark. Seattle misses outfielder Victor Robles (10-day IL, pectoral strain), while the Padres placed starter Nick Pivetta on the 15-day IL with elbow inflammation just before the series, though their bullpen depth remains intact amid a recent hot streak.
